Lower Canada 1837 - Champlain and St. Lawrence Railroad - 15 Sous, Quarter Dollar, Half Dollar (Full Uncut Dual Series Sheet)

This A and B series structure reflects controlled production and accounting methodology rather than decorative layout. The mirrored pairing strongly suggests intentional issuance logic, likely used for tracking, validation, or balanced distribution within the railroad’s operational and financial system.
